    Abstract

    In order to investigate the effect of carbonization temperature on the electrocatalytic performance of CF/Pd catalysts for methanol oxidation, a series of CF/Pd catalysts were prepared by electrospinning heat treatment carbonization impregnation method. The carbonization temperatures were set at 800, 1 000, and 1 200 ℃, respectively. The obtained CF/Pd catalyst samples were characterized by microscopic morphology, composition analysis, and electrochemical testing. Research has found that at 800 ℃, PAN/CA fibers have completely carbonized, but as the carbonization temperature increases, the degree of fibrosis of CF/Pd catalysts gradually decreases, and the bonding phenomenon becomes more obvious. The electrocatalytic performance of methanol oxidation shows a trend of first increasing and then decreasing. When the carbonization temperature is 1 000 ℃, the CF/Pd catalyst has the best electrocatalytic performance for methanol oxidation, with a catalytic activity 5.4 times that of commercial Pd/C catalysts and a stability 16.2 times that of commercial Pd/C catalysts.
